Finnish Nokia returns with an Android tablet – TeK.sapo

The equipment is called N1 and will take advantage of Nokia Z Launcher interface. Will integrate an Atom Z3580 processor at 2.3 GHz, with graphics PowerVR G6430 533 MHz. The memory is 2GB and the storage space of 32GB.
 

The N1 will have a 7.9-inch IPS display with Gorilla Glass 3:01 resolution of 2048×1536 pixels. The rear camera is 8 megapixels and the front camera of 5 megapixels. Will run at 5 version of Android, known as Lollipop and ensure Bluetooth and Wi-Fi connectivity.
 
 

The new tablet will be manufactured and marketed by a partner with whom the Finnish manufacturer concluded an agreement for transfer of the trademark and licensing of industrial design Z Launcher.
 
 
 
 

The device will hit stores in the first quarter of next year. For now, the date of sale is valid only for China, although the sale is also planned in other markets. In that country the N1 will have a suggested retail price (before taxes) of $ 249.
 

The Nokia emphasizes that the product makes a bet on a careful design and simplicity. “We are pleased to be able to carry the Nokia brand to consumers again with the Android tablet N1, helping to create simple and sophisticated technologies” said Sebastian Nystrom, product manager at Nokia Technologies, in a statement.
 

The Nokia unit phones sold to Microsoft in September last year in a deal that allowed the owner to use the Windows Phone brand, what happened up there about a month. The first Nokia Lumia without brand was introduced last November 11.
